Line Voltage & Phase Sequence Detector
208D-208/240VAC
The Model 208 Line Voltage & Phase Sequence Detector provides essential monitoring for industrial electrical systems. Operating at 208/240V and 400Hz, this device offers continuous connection for reliable performance. Its primary function is to indicate normal phase rotation (ABC or CBA) and identify missing phases (A, B, or C). This capability is crucial for maintaining operational integrity and preventing potential equipment damage due to incorrect phasing or power interruptions. The detector's clear lamp indicators provide immediate visual feedback, allowing for prompt identification of system anomalies. Its utility lies in its direct, unambiguous reporting of critical power conditions.

Specifications
| Voltage | 208/240V |
|---|---|
| Frequency | 400Hz |
| Connection Time | Continuous |
| Leads | Fly leads |
| Enclosure Material | ABS plastic |
| Function | Indicates Normal Condition |
| Function | Shows Missing Phase |
| Function | Indicates Phase Sequence ABC or CBA |
| Condition: ABC ROTATION | Lamps Lit: ABC, A, B, C |
| Condition: CBA ROTATION | Lamps Lit: CBA, A, B, C |
| Condition: PHASE A MISSING | Lamps Lit: ABC, CBA, B, C |
| Condition: PHASE B MISSING | Lamps Lit: ABC, CBA, A, C |
| Condition: PHASE C MISSING | Lamps Lit: ABC, CBA, A, B |
FAQs
How does the detector indicate normal phase sequence?
The detector indicates normal phase sequence (ABC or CBA rotation) through specific lamp patterns. For ABC rotation, lamps ABC, A, B, and C are lit. For CBA rotation, lamps CBA, A, B, and C are lit.
What visual indication is provided if a phase is missing?
If Phase A is missing, lamps ABC, CBA, B, and C are lit. If Phase B is missing, lamps ABC, CBA, A, and C are lit. If Phase C is missing, lamps ABC, CBA, A, and B are lit.
